American Beech and Chinkapin Oak Diseases

Plants get infected many times due to lack of care. This makes it unhealthy and reduces its life too. Hence it is necessary to know the kind of disease on plants, to cure it and keep the plant healthy. Knowing About American Beech and Chinkapin Oak diseases is very important factor of American Beech and Chinkapin Oak Care. These plant's diseases are:

  • American Beech: Aphids, Beech bark disease, fungus, Mildew and Scale
  • Chinkapin Oak: Insects and Red blotch

American Beech and Chinkapin Oak Pruning

Pruning is an important part of American Beech and Chinkapin Oak care. Pruning helps to grow the plant with a faster rate. American Beech and Chinkapin Oak pruning is done as follows:

  • American Beech pruning: Cut upper 1/3 section when young to enhancegrowth, Prune to control growth, Remove damaged leaves, Remove dead branches and Remove dead leaves

  • Chinkapin Oak pruning: Remove damaged leaves, Remove dead leaves, Remove dead or diseased plant parts and Remove hanging branches
